  • Creep

    Creep

    ★★★½

    “Creep” is a captivating blend of awkward humor and intense horror. The filmmakers, Patrick Brice and Mark Duplass, masterfully create sequences that oscillate between profound terror and genuine laughter.
    From the very beginning, Brice and Duplass’s commitment to authenticity stands out. Their performances are oddly detailed and naturalistic, contributing to the shivering and indelible atmosphere throughout the film.
